Step-by-Step for you to enrol for our au pair accommodation
service:
1. Fill out application
form on website and send to Au Pair House
2.
Au Pair House will send the details of our program and a questionaire
to be answered by the au pair candidate
3.
Once we have received the questionaire back, Au Pair House matches
a family that is best suited with the au pair requests
4.
Au Pair House sends family profile
5.
Au pair acccepts or does not accept the family, if not Au Pair House
sends more options
6.
Once the family profile is accepted, Au Pair House will send to
the au pair:
· Family profile including photos
· Agreement Document
· Bus timetable and map of home location
· Invoice for fee payment
7. Au
Pair House must receive payment before the invoice due date, which
is always before the au pair arrival
8.
Once payment is received, Au Pair House will send to au pair:
· Confirmation of Enrolment and Receipt
of payment
· Airport pick-up details, including map for meeting point
9. Once au pair arrives
in Australia or at arranged meeting point, Au Pair House will:
· Take the au pair to the family house
· Conduct orientation with the au pair
10.
During the au pair’s stay, Au Pair House will always be able
to be contacted by the au pair for assistance.
Attention:
· Au Pair programs as an accommodation
option:
If you compare the prices of our programs with normal rental prices
(including food, electricity, bond etc.) or homestay fees, you will
realise that this is the best quality and highest standard type
of accommodation and the most affordable way to live on the Gold
Coast or country sites in Australia. However, the au pair must be
aware that it is a job, and it comes with responsibilities and duties
that must be complied with. The au pair will sign a contract along
with other forms during the orientation, which happens on the first
day after arrival. The au pair and the family can terminate the
agreement at any stage if the placement is not satisfactory, giving
2 weeks notice. Au Pair House will offer another family to the au
pair if placement is found not suitable, however this offer is only
available during the first month of placement.
· If you wish to extend the program:
The program length is indefinite, however the families expect the
au pair to stay at least 3 months. If the au pair and family wish
to continue the arrangements it is totally up to them. Au Pair House
can no longer assist with the extension of more than 3 months with
the same family. If the au pair wishes to finish the program before
completing 3 months, a 14-day notice must be given to the family.
BUT, if an au pair wishes to continue the program after the first
3 months with a different family, Au Pair House offers the same
service for only half price.
· If you want to be an au pair and
study at the same time:
There are many families that need help at the end of the day. So
if you wish to study, you must mention in your application form
the school location, the timetable, and the length of the course.
That way, we can look into matching your request with the families
available in the area. If you need help to find a course or school,
please advise, as we can help with your school enrolment as well
at no extra charge! We advise that you choose a school that offers
